Servicing costs are quite reasonable, as is the level of service from Toyota dealers. Performance from the 94 kilowatt engine was good, in either manual or multi-mode automatic models.Ĭars are capable of easy 180kph cruising on the open road.įuel consumption can be heavy around town (12l/100kms), but much better on the open road (8l/100kms).Īutomatic models have power/economy mode transmissions, power mode on the open road provides good over-taking ability. Their handling is peerless and leaves everything else for dead (thanks to Chris Amon modifications, which were unique to the New Zealand market). These cars have almost faultless reliability. Sold from 1992 to 1996, these cars were superior in almost every way to their competition of the time Ford Telstar, Mazda 626, Mitsubishi Galant, along with most imported models. The most under-rated car ever sold in New Zealand. The problems these cars have are relatively simple fixes, but you'll most likely always have problems here and there due to the age.įront disc brakes needed replacing at 140,000 kilometers.Įngine began to idle above normal revs, 1100 instead of 700, fixed by the dealer at a service.
